Here is a look at what we did in centers this week.
Art Easel- The class used paint sticks to color in "My House" projects, where painters tape house outlines were removed afterwards to reveal the finished houses. The kids had a great time with this project! At the end of the week, we used watercolors and preschool themed coloring pages.
Art/Writing table- Here the class used differently shaped stamps and ink pads, as well as markers and crayons to decorate cutout paper houses to be hung with their family pictures on our family wall. Thankyou to all who have sent one in! The kids loved being able to look at their pictures and tell us all about them.
Math table- Here we had colored houses alongside colored people and animal figures where the children counted how many people are in their own houses, and pets! They were also able to color sort the figures into the correct houses.
The discovery center- Here the class was prompted to build their own houses using material such as playdough, Q-Tip's, Duplo Legos, popsicle sticks, and straws. This center was very busy throughout the week and coincided with our reading of The Three Little Pigs in class.
Our sensory table is apple pie themed for the month of September, and includes red pompoms, oats, baking utensils and pans, and miniature plastic apples. I have loved being able to here the children talking about their baking creations, we've had many cakes, pies, and even lasagna!
